Quinoa Fruit Salad Recipe

To prepare the salad, simply combine all ingredients in a bowl and stir. For even more flavor, feel free to experiment with other fruits, such as raspberries, strawberries, or oranges. Finally, garnish with the mint leaves for a touch of extra color and flavor. Enjoy!

Prep. Time: 10Min. Cooking Time: 15min. Servings: 3

Ingredients

  • 1 cup quinoa
  • 2 teaspoons honey
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ice (freshly squeezed is best)
  • 1 tablespoon orange juice 
  • 1/2 tbsp salt and pepper
  • 1/2 cup fresh blueberries
  • 1/2 cup fresh strawberries or cherries sliced
  • 1/2 cup cubed, seedless watermelon
  • 1 ripe peach or nectarine (diced)
  • Fresh m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Preparation

  1. Rinse and drain quinoa, then transfer it to a medium pot over medium-high heat.
  2. Toast, stirring often, until lightly browned and fragrant – about one to two minutes depending on your stove’s heat level.
  3. Pour 2 cups of water into the pot with the quinoa and bring to a boil; reduce heat and simmer for 15 minutes or until liquid is absorbed and quinoa is cooked through, stirring occasionally throughout cooking time.
  4. While quinoa is cooking, prepare the dressing: In a bowl whisk together honey, lime juice and orange juice until creamy, season with salt & pepper; set aside while you finish prepping other ingredients such as cutting up fruit like apples, pears & mangoes if using.
  5. Once cooked fully, fluff warm quinoa with fork
  6. Add in cut fruits like berries, watermelon, etc.
  7. Pour prepared honey lime dressing over top & fold in gently using spoon to combine evenly without mushing up any of the fresh fruits added in earlier. Serve chilled or at room temp. Enjoy!

Nutritional Value: 150kcal./serving

Benefits of the Recipe

image 47

Quinoa is a unique fruit salad ingredient due to its numerous health benefits. This ingredient is high in protein and essential amino acids, and provides a multitude of vitamins and minerals. It is also gluten-free, which strengthens its health benefits for many people who are looking for an alternative to wheat-based products. Additionally, quinoa is relatively low in calories while still boasting a considerable amount of dietary fiber.

This fruit salad recipe combines the health benefits of quinoa with the goodness of honey, lime, and fresh fruits to provide you with a nutritious meal that can be eaten as a snack or main course.

  • Honey helps complement the fresh fruit flavors in this dish while providing additional antioxidants and B vitamins that help boost overall health.
  • Lime juice not only adds zesty flavor but it also helps to keep the ingredients fresh and provides vitamin C as well as other beneficial compounds like limonene and citric acid that help support gut health.
  • Adding fresh fruits like apples, oranges, blueberries, or strawberries creates an eye pleasing dish with layers of flavor subtle sweetness from these natural ingredients.

Variations of the Recipe

There are countless ways to vary this healthy, delicious and bright fruit salad. Depending on your preferences and dietary restrictions, you can easily customize the recipe to your taste.

For a vegan variation, substitute a vegan-friendly sweetener such as agave nectar or maple syrup for the honey in the dressing. For those looking for a creative twist on the dish, feel free to experiment with various types of fruits and nuts that are native to your region. For example, try adding figs, dates or dried apricots for an extra layer of sweetness; or swap out almonds for pumpkin seeds (or any nut of your choosing) for an added punch of flavor and texture.

If you are looking for something even heartier, add some cooked quinoa or other grains of your choice – including millet or amaranth – to make the dish a meal-in-one. You can also top it with grilled chicken or shrimp if desired. Adding grilled vegetables like eggplant, zucchini, bell peppers and onions is another great way to keep the flavors popping and ensure that each bite is unique and flavorful!

Tips & Tricks

For maximum flavor, it is integral to season the quinoa properly with cloves, nutmeg and cinnamon. Additionally, use the most seasonal or freshest fruits available and make sure they are ripe. Use a light touch when tossing the fruit salad. Too much handling can cause everything to become mushy instead of staying fresh and crisp.

Serving Suggestions

This honey lime quinoa fruit salad is a versatile side dish great for any occasion. This gluten-free, vegan-friendly recipe can be served as either a main dish or as an accompaniment to any meal. Try it with grilled shrimp and vegetables for a light summer lunch, or bring it to your next potluck to share the deliciousness.

When serving this dish, be sure to use fresh seasonal fruit for best flavor and maximum visual impact. Consider pairing the honey lime quinoa fruit salad with a variety of items such as:

  • Greek yogurt
  • Macadamia nuts
  • Shredded coconut
  • Crumbled feta cheese

You can also top the dish with a variety of herbs such as mint, basil or cilantro to add an extra layer of depth and complexity of flavor. Add zest to your presentation by garnishing with slices of fresh citrus or lime wedges before serving. Enjoy!
